Famous Couples

Inspired by Penguin Books’ new series, Famous Couples, my class was prompted to share the essence of an iconic duo through visual storytelling. Our challenge was to design a complete book jacket that successfully captured the characteristics of the relationship. 

With this in mind, I chose Dani Ardor and Christian Hughes from the iconic horror film, Midsommar (2019), for their woeful and complicated journey as a couple. In my cover, I sought to incorporate elements of their unique story throughout the design, taking inspiration from both characters' individual tales.

Social Issue Campaign

For this project, we were instructed to create a poster campaign for our social justice issue that resonated personally with us. Being the daughter of Vietnamese refugees, I wanted to share my perspective on our country's current conflicted feelings toward immigration through a clear and concise message.
